EPA’s war on siloxanes, a silicone derivative that comes from sand

Have You Used Siloxanes Today? Yes!


Back in 2010, I wrote about the EPA’s war on siloxanes, a silicone derivative that comes from sand. At the time I noted that siloxanes were “inert, non-allergenic, odorless, and colorless” and that they have been safely used for decades in thousands of consumer and industrial products.”
